All Categories
Featured
Table of Contents
"If you don't have a procedure, it's not going to be feasible to figure one out on the fly," Chris explains. "Think of exactly how to do this before the meeting. For instance, one that I suggest to individuals is PEDAC." This return around to the idea of practice! Even if a firm isn't your dream area to function, if they welcome you for the tech interview phase, go.
As Parker continues: "With a little bit of effort, it's feasible to really change your way of thinking from 'I'm an impostor' to 'Most of us have our strengths and our powerlessness. I'm respectable at some things, and I'm excited to get more information concerning a few other stuff.'" Ultimately, planning for a shows interview frequently boils down to exercise.
Firm Call]
What are the technological facets that require to be covered for the technical meeting? Firm Domain name] You could additionally offer it an inquiry and exactly how you would answer it, then ask ChatGPT to rate your feedback with a 1-5 rating and give pointers on how to boost your solution.
Time out for a minute to analyze the analytical process." People would certainly rather collaborate with a modest person than a conceited know-it-all. Particularly for those with fewer years of experience, "it's more crucial to find across as being malleable and excited to discover, so the employer can visualize you in a range of projects and functions," claims Chris of Launch Institution.
: 'I've been appreciating X recently, however additionally have experience with Y.'" Keep in mind, your job interviewers are human! "An interview is not just regarding responding to questions correctly, yet additionally regarding a conversation," says Chris.
At the end of the interview, even if you missed a few inquiries, the general sensation the recruiter has concerning you should be favorable. For more technology interview prep work, check out these resources!
Above all, keep seeking out understanding, improving your profession, and developing those coding interview abilities with technique! Getting your desire coding task implies getting with the meeting.
Should you study specific technological jobs or usually freshen on a lot of subjects? Should you practice on a computer system or with a buddy? As the 3rd engineer at Pocket Gems, which has around 165 technical staff members, I've performed hundreds of phone and on-site interviews. Throughout this time, I have actually learned a lot regarding how to correctly plan for one.
Recruiters are primarily going to ask you questions about your basics: information frameworks, mathematical intricacy evaluation, class design, and so on. These will be inquiries both directly concerning principles (e.g., use X to do Y) and concerns for which you will utilize your fundamentals (much more on that particular below). Think of basics as the tools in your toolbox.
With solid fundamentals, you'll be much better prepared to tackle open-ended problemsthe sort of issues that we and many other startups resolve on an everyday basis. By concentrating on fundamentals, recruiters can spend much less time establishing the meeting inquiries and more time seeing just how you believe. For instance, you may be asked something like: You're given a binary tree and 2 nodes in the tree.
What's the most effective task for you? Use The Muse to find a job at a company with a society you enjoy. Select the job path that straightens with you: The amount of years of experience do you have? What business benefits are crucial to you? Computing your task suits ... With this inquiry, the job interviewer is looking to see just how well you can communicate your thought process and option.
Each of your principles has advantages and disadvantages and offers a special option for a certain kind of problem. After recruiters ask you a concern exclusively on your principles, they're most likely visiting how you can utilize them in method. This is achieved by asking flexible concerns that can be solved in a range of methods.
Example inputs include "1 +1" and "2 *(1 +9)-((2 +5)-9"). As before, the interviewer desires to see just how you damage down flexible concerns and your idea process in picking your service.
Whatever the question or what remedy you select, see to it to believe out loud! If you have different ways of fixing the problem, talk through the choices prior to deciding which to make use of. It helps the interviewer see and understand your thought process - software engineer prep course. Likewise, the job interviewer may recommend one option over the others due to the fact that he or she understands that the others may have certain challenges or might be beyond the range of the meeting.
These reveal you're believing, tooand offer the interviewer a feeling of how you would certainly collaborate with others. Make certain you're asking making clear questions to totally recognize the question which you're not increasing the size of the scope of the problem (e.g., What are some example inputs? Do I need to worry about dividing by 0? Do I have to fret about daytime financial savings?) Make sure you verbally run through a few test instances before you state you're ended up.
As very easy as it would certainly make task meetings, we however can not read your mind. As you're preparing, technique addressing questions with various devices from your toolbox so that you create an instinct about it. Know when to utilize each of your devices so that you will not get floundered during the interview.
Table of Contents
Latest Posts
What Is The Leading Strategy For Acing Interview Roadmap For Engineers?
What Should I Expect From Machine Learning Skills?
What Are The Key Takeaways From Learning Coding Practice Tests?
More
Latest Posts
What Is The Leading Strategy For Acing Interview Roadmap For Engineers?
What Should I Expect From Machine Learning Skills?
What Are The Key Takeaways From Learning Coding Practice Tests?